Blind Assessment
Evaluated as espresso. Richly chocolaty, deep-toned. Dark chocolate, date, pink peppercorn, tangerine zest, sandalwood in aroma and small cup. Crisp, velvety mouthfeel; chocolaty finish with undertones of pink peppercorn. In cappuccino format, richly chocolaty, through and through, with gentle subtones of pink peppercorn.
Notes
Produced by smallholding farmers and processed by the washed method (fruit skin and pulp removed before drying). Beyond 85 Coffee is a retail and wholesale coffee company founded by roasting expert Jose Bedoya and former ICO chair and farmer Roberto Giesemann, that is focused on locally sourced and roasted Colombian coffees. Beyond 85 is a Florida-based company but roasts in Huila, Colombia. Visit www.beyond85coffee.com for more information.
Bottom Line
A chocolaty, spice-toned single-origin Colombia espresso complicated by bittersweet citrus notes — appealing in both the straight shot and in milk.
